ACIT Vs Abhyudaya Co-op Bank Limited (ITAT Mumbai) The ITAT Mumbai has ruled in favor of Abhyudaya Co-op Bank Limited in an appeal filed by the Revenue. The case involved the allowance of bad debts declared as Non Performing Assets (NPS) before 01.04.2006 as a deduction under section 36(1)(vii) of the Income Tax Act for the assessment year 2012-13. The Revenue challenged the deduction claimed by the assessee for bad debts under section 36(1)(vii), arguing that the provisions of section 36(1)(viia) should apply.
